Deck Floor Replacement Questions
What are signs that a deck floor needs replacement? Visible rot, sagging, loose boards, or extensive cracking indicate the need for deck floor replacement.
Can a deck floor be replaced without rebuilding the entire deck? Yes, specific sections of the deck floor can often be replaced independently if the underlying structure remains sound.
What materials are commonly used for deck floor replacement? Pressure-treated wood, composite decking, and PVC are popular options for replacing deck floors.
Is deck floor replacement suitable for all types of decks? It is suitable for most residential decks, especially when the existing structure is still in good condition.
